    7 Reasons Why You Need Rewards and Recognition Technology

    In today’s world, organizations are constantly looking for ways to boost employee morale, increase productivity, and create a culture of appreciation. One effective way to achieve these goals is through rewards and recognition technology. But what exactly does this technology do? Simply put, it provides businesses with tools to acknowledge and celebrate the hard work of their employees in real-time. 

    As more companies move toward remote or hybrid work models, ensuring employees feel valued has become more important than ever.

    This article will explain why rewards and recognition technology are essential for any modern organization. You will learn how using these tools can improve employee satisfaction, engagement, and retention.

    1. Why Recognition Is More Important Than Ever

    In today’s fast-paced work environment, employees often feel like their hard work goes unnoticed. Without regular acknowledgment, people may become disengaged, leading to a decrease in productivity. Traditionally, employee recognition involves personal praise from managers or formal awards during meetings. However, with hybrid and remote work becoming the norm, it’s harder for teams to come together in person and celebrate success.

    This is where rewards and recognition technology play a crucial role. It allows companies to offer recognition at scale, ensuring that all employees receive the appreciation they deserve, no matter where they are. Additionally, it helps businesses track performance and create a consistent approach to recognition that aligns with company values.

    2. Streamlining Recognition with Technology

    Rewards and recognition technology simplifies the process of acknowledging employees. By using a digital platform, managers and peers can send messages, badges, or even small gifts to celebrate achievements. These tools are especially effective in hybrid or remote teams, where traditional in-person recognition can be challenging.

    In today’s digital workplace, group ecards are a simple and popular way to recognize employees. These digital cards allow colleagues to send quick and meaningful messages of appreciation to one another. Sending a group ecard is a simple but powerful way to celebrate a birthday, work anniversary, or successful project completion. It’s a quick and personal way to show recognition without waiting for the next team meeting or in-person gathering.

    3. Creating a Culture of Appreciation

    A strong company culture is built on the foundation of appreciation. When employees feel valued, they are more likely to be engaged, loyal, and motivated. Rewards and recognition technology helps to create and maintain a positive culture by making appreciation an ongoing part of daily work life.

    With these platforms, managers can send consistent feedback and recognition for even the smallest wins. This helps employees feel their contributions matter, leading to a more positive and supportive workplace. The more recognition is integrated into daily operations, the more it fosters an environment where employees are encouraged to perform at their best.

    4. Improving Employee Morale and Job Satisfaction

    Job satisfaction is closely tied to how valued employees feel. A lack of recognition can lead to burnout and disengagement, but on the other hand, consistent appreciation boosts morale. Employees who feel recognized and valued are not only more satisfied with their jobs, but they are also more likely to perform well and stay with the company long-term.

    By using rewards and recognition technology, companies can provide real-time feedback, which helps employees feel appreciated instantly. Whether it’s acknowledging a job well done, a milestone achieved, or simply recognizing consistent hard work, technology allows for a quicker, more effective acknowledgment process.

    5. Boosting Employee Motivation and Performance

    Rewards and recognition technology actively enhance employee motivation because of its main benefit. The knowledge of receiving acknowledgment turns staff members into more dedicated workers who perform extra duties in their positions. A digital recognition system that permits coworkers to appreciate each other enables the creation of an environment where teamwork and mutual assistance thrive.

    Digital recognition systems connect to performance metrics through which employees receive rewards according to their individual achievements. The performance-based reward systems drive workers to achieve peak standards through their knowledge of upcoming recognition opportunities. Such an environment creates teamwork between employees who challenge each other but still support one another toward peak performance.

    6. The Convenience of Rewards at Scale

    Employee recognition management in big organizations becomes difficult to handle through manual systems. Using proper technology enables businesses to simplify their recognition system, allowing them to distribute recognition to all employees at once. The application of automated processes allows managers to provide personalized messaging services while tracking employee performance outcomes so they can recognize every team member.

    Digital tools enable organizations to develop rewards based on corporate objectives that match company values. Organizations provide workers with electronic vouchers along with experiential benefits like virtual learning capabilities and additional freedom. An organization that explores various options can provide unique recognition programs that cater to each staff member’s preferences.

    7. The Long-Term Impact on Employee Retention

    Corporate employee retention has become a critical issue that many companies face, particularly those operating in highly competitive markets. Greater appreciation among employees creates a lower risk of one-dimensional professional movement. A culture of recognition stands as the best approach to improve retention because it demonstrates that employees receive appreciation for their work.

    By using rewards and recognition technology, companies can ensure that employees are consistently recognized, which helps them feel more connected to the organization. Regular recognition, paired with tangible rewards, shows that the company is invested in their well-being, making them more likely to stay long-term.

    Comparison Table: Top Rewards and Recognition Technology Tools

    Here’s a comparison table to help you evaluate the best rewards and recognition technology options for your organization:

    ToolFeaturesBest ForCost
    BonuslyPeer-to-peer recognition, reward pointsSmall and medium businessesPaid Subscription
    15FiveContinuous feedback, performance trackingLarger organizations with feedback needsPaid Subscription
    AwardcoReward catalog, integration with platformsCustomizable rewards for large teamsPaid Subscription
    GiftogramDigital gift cards, reward catalogPersonalized gifts and incentivesFree/Paid Options
